dc.description.abstractThe production and sale of lithium-ion batteries for industrial and household use is rapidly developing [1]. Currently, the recycling of lithium-ion batteries is very limited [2]. Uncontrolled penetration intake of lithium into the body with drinking water, food, air is a threat of toxic effects. Another source of lithium penetration into the human body are pharmacological drugs of lithium, which are widely used in the treatment and prevention of psychiatric disorders [3]. In the toxic doses of the lithium inhibits a number of glycolysis enzymes. It acts as a non-competitive inhibitor of the main electrolytes of the body: potassium, sodium, calcium, magnesium [4]. In the human body and animals, there are no mechanisms of lithium homeostasis, so its contents in the body should be monitored [5].en_US
